Summarize shortly the most important talents you have specialized into and how can you change them to adjust for the fight?
I use a bit different talents in raids and different in M+ but fair enough
There's 7 tiers so I'll just write number of tier and the choice
HOLY:
1. Enlightenment for raids (more mp5) and Trail of Light for M+
2. feather for raids, Angel's mercy for m+
3 Cosmic ripple
4 Censure (nothing like a good stun)
5 Binding heal, any time
6 Benediction, Halo is situational, not always the best choice, especially if there is a danger of breaking a cc etc. Star is also kinda alright, on stacked fights like Vari or Argus
7 Salvation. I dont get how you'd chose another. basically cast and go afk kinda button
Disc:
1 Castigation in raids, Schism in dungeons
2 Fearther
3 Shield discipline or Solace. Mana returns from mindbender arent that great at all in comparison
4 useless for raids or at the very best situational talents, Shining force for m+
5 Contrition
6 Halo for raids, even though DS is ok as well. PtW for dungeons
7 Luminous Barrier is nice, but there are arguments Evangelism is just as good (I prefer the mass bubbles though)
